What are Poker Casino Tournaments?

Poker casino tournaments are competitive events where players compete against each other to win cash prizes and other rewards. These tournaments can take place in both online and land-based casinos, offering players the chance to test their skills in a challenging and rewarding environment. Players must use a combination of strategy, skill, and luck to outsmart their opponents and emerge victorious.

How to Play

Playing in a poker casino tournament is similar to playing in a regular poker game, with a few key differences. In a tournament, players buy in for a set amount of chips and compete against each other until one player has all the chips. The blinds increase at regular intervals, putting pressure on players to make strategic decisions and accumulate chips. The last player standing wins the tournament and takes home the top prize.

House Edge

When it comes to the house edge in poker casino tournaments, it is important to understand that the casino does not have a direct stake in the outcome of the game. Instead, the house collects a fee from each player’s buy-in, known as the “rake,” which is used to cover the costs of running the tournament. The actual gameplay is between the players themselves, with the house acting as a neutral referee.

Payouts

The payouts in poker casino tournaments vary depending on the size of the prize pool and the number of players participating. The top finishers typically receive the largest payouts, with the winner taking home the lion’s share of the prize money. Some tournaments also offer additional prizes, such as entry into other tournaments or sponsorship deals.
